Place the chopped potatoes in a large pot and cover with water. Bring to a boil over high heat and cook until the potatoes are tender when pierced with a fork, about 15-20 minutes.
While the potatoes are cooking, melt the butter in a small saucepan over low heat. Add the minced or roasted garlic and cook for 1-2 minutes, stirring frequently, until fragrant. Remove from heat and set aside.
Drain the cooked potatoes and return them to the pot. Add the garlic butter, milk or cream, salt, and black pepper.
Mash the potatoes with a potato masher or electric mixer until they are smooth and creamy. Adjust the consistency with additional milk or cream if needed.
Serve hot and enjoy!
Optional: You can also sprinkle chopped fresh chives or grated Parmesan cheese on top of the mashed potatoes for added flavor and visual appeal.
